Salvatore Antonio

Salvatore Antonio was born in Toronto, Canada, and trained as an actor at the prestigious National Theatre School of Canada, where he is now a guest instructor. Known primarily for his work on stage, screen and television, In Gabriel’s Kitchen is his first full-length play. Since its premiere at Buddies in Bad Times Theatre in Toronto in March 2006, In Gabriel’s Kitchen has been produced in Italian translation, at Teatro Della Limonaia in Florence, Italy, and is set to have its U.S. premiere at The New Conservatory Theater of San Francisco in early 2008. As a writer, Salvatore has been Playwright-In-Residence at Buddies in Bad Times Theatre (Toronto), where he was also a member of the AnteChamber Writers’ Unit. He is currently a member of the Writers’ Unit at Tarragon Theatre (Toronto), where he is working on two new plays: LOAD and The Coronation of Medusa Regina.
